  • n. The condition or quality of being insignificant; lack of significance, sense, or meaning.
  • n. Lack of force or effect; unimportance; pettiness; inefficacy.
  • n. Lack of claim to consideration or notice; lack of influence or standing; meanness.
  • The Century Dictionary and Cyclopedia
  • n. The quality or condition of being insignificant; lack of significance or import; unimportance; triviality; meanness; want of force, influence, or consideration.
